WebAug 31, 2016 · For a start, still in Mail pane, click in the search box to bring out the “Search” ribbon. Then in the group of “Options”, click on “Search Tools” and select “Advanced Find” from its drop down list. Next you will get into the “Advanced Find” dialog box. Click “Browse” button to choose the mail folder where you wish to search the specific phrases. Click the Search dropdown … WebMay 11, 2024 · Right click on the Outlook ribbon. 2. Select Customize the Ribbon. 3. Select Home (Mail) located in the list on the right-hand side. 4. In the Choose commands from the list on the left side, select All Tabs. 5. Under Search Tools, select Search. 6. Between the two lists, click Add to move Search from the left list to the right list. 7.
